Every Friday afternoon, two
girls called Amy and Claire, from Sunderland University, come into
school to work with year 6.
We have to warm up our muscles so that
we don’t pull or strain them. We do races, stretches and physical
challenges.
Then we practiice our dance routines. We dance to pop,
street dance, and to relaxed music. At the end, we cool down with
more stretches and the Mexican Wave!
